This research is devoted to a comprehensive analysis of optimization methods for modern web applications developed using Java on the server side and HTML5/CSS Grid on the client side. The paper examines key performance aspects, including optimization of server-side Java logic, effective use of CSS Grid for creating adaptive interfaces, and integration of these technologies to achieve maximum web application performance. The study includes an analysis of existing optimization approaches, proposes new methodologies for improving performance, and demonstrates their effectiveness through practical examples. Special attention is paid to aspects such as minimizing page load time, optimizing network requests, effective caching, rational use of memory on server and client, and automating optimization processes. The results show that an integrated approach to optimization, encompassing both server and client sides, allows for significant improvements in web application performance compared to traditional methods focused on only one side. The methodologies and recommendations presented in this study can be useful for developers and software architects seeking to improve the efficiency and quality of web applications, especially in the context of growing user expectations and increasing complexity of modern web systems.
